<h3>Dietary Reference Intake and calcium </h3>

Dietary Reference Intake (DRI) refers to recommended amounts to plan nutrient intake in healthy individuals.

Calcium is an essential micronutrient (i.e., it is a mineral) that must be regularly (daily) obtained from the diet.

The recommended intake of calcium is 1000 mg in adults from 19 to 50 years, 1100 mg for 51 to 70 years, and 1200 mg for adults older than 70 years.

The immune system is the complex collection of cells and organs that destroys or neutralizes pathogens that would otherwise cause disease or death. The lymphatic system, for most people, is associated with the immune system to such a degree that the two systems are virtually indistinguishable. The lymphatic system is the system of vessels, cells, and organs that carries excess fluids to the bloodstream and filters pathogens from the blood. The swelling of lymph nodes during an infection and the transport of lymphocytes via the lymphatic vessels are but two examples of the many connections between these critical organ systems.
